Skimmer doesnt bubble as high up??

Ok I'm new to this. But I set my skimmer up HOB Coralife super skimmer 220. Started bubbling like mad for a few days. It seemed to be adjusted right with the bubble coming half way up the center tube in the collection cup.

Well I just looked over and seems as though the bubble have dropped way down again into the main chamber, not even coming us as high as the collection cup.

Why is it doing this? Water level didn't come since yesterday. Didn't change the mix or anything??? Is this normal?

I don't know how long your CCS skimmer has been running.
but according to instructions when 1st getting the skimmer to work you must open the flow valve all the way open and must adjust the valve on top (red)......which controls the microbubbles
going into tank
also your skimmer might be working,but you might not have a large bioload for the skimmer to actually skim anything..
